Reba McEntire, Keith Urban, Alan Jackson and Keith Anderson are all taking their clothes off -- for a good cause. The celebrities are among those who have donated autographed articles of clothing to raise funds for Porter's Call, a Tennessee-based organization providing free counseling and support for artists and their families in need.

Partnering with auction website Clothes Off Our Back, more than 30 artists and celebrities, including the Jonas Brothers, Tim McGraw, Sara Evans, Gene Simmons, Billy Bob Thornton and Paramore have all donated one-of-a-kind items. The memorabilia includes signed guitars, concert tickets, CD's and DVD's. There's even a signed Super Bowl XLI football from the IIndianapolis Colts.
